The scanning process system is the method of converting physical paper documents into digital formats using a scanner and document management software. It helps organizations store, manage, and access information electronically instead of using paper files.
The process typically involves several steps:
First, documents are collected and prepared by removing staples, clips, or any damage that may affect scanning. Next, the documents are fed into a scanner, where they are converted into digital images. Modern scanners can handle large volumes quickly and may support features like duplex scanning (scanning both sides at once).
After scanning, the images are processed to improve quality. This may include adjusting brightness, removing noise, or correcting alignment. The next step is indexing, where important details like document name, date, or category are added so files can be easily searched later.
Finally, the scanned documents are stored in a digital system such as a document management system or cloud storage for easy access, sharing, and backup.
Overall, the scanning process system improves efficiency, reduces paper usage, enhances data security, and supports smooth digital record management in businesses.

Environmental scanning is a process of gathering, analyzing, and dispensing information for tactical or strategic purposes. The environmental scanning process entails obtaining both factual and subjective information on the business environments in which a company is operating or considering entering.
Biometrics is the system of identifying humans through personal characteristics. Examples of biometric systems include the scanning of the iris/retina, fingerprint scanning, and handwriting scanning. Another example of a biometric system is the scanning of the voice in order to recognise the speaker.
Scanning in information assurance involves using tools to search and analyze a network for vulnerabilities and weak points. Footprinting is the first step in scanning, where attackers gather information about the target system to understand its structure and potential entry points. Enumeration is the process of extracting more detailed information about the target system, such as usernames and network resources, to plan a potential attack.

To optimize the process of scanning negatives with a flatbed scanner, ensure the negatives are clean and free of dust, use a high resolution setting, adjust the exposure and color settings as needed, and consider using a film holder or mask to keep the negatives flat and in place during scanning.
A self-feeding scanner for document digitization offers benefits such as faster scanning speed, increased automation, and reduced manual effort. It improves efficiency by allowing multiple documents to be scanned in a continuous process without the need for constant monitoring or manual intervention, saving time and streamlining the scanning process.
